Rupert Grint Talks Filming WIld Target
Posted by Megs

Musicrooms has a new interview with Rupert Grint where he discusses his new film Wild Target.

“It’s quite embarrassing where I had to stand in the bath, I had a jock strap kind of thing, it was weird because it wasn’t water, it was milk… to make the water look cloudy so you couldn’t see anything – we were in a bath of milk. Thankfully there weren’t many people on set just me and Bill. He didn’t really say very much, but yes it did feel just a bit uncomfortable for the both of us.”

While the 21-year-old star – who is best known for portraying wizard Ron Weasley in the ‘Harry Potter’ films – felt awkward about being near-naked in front of his co-star, he isn’t worried about audiences seeing him naked – even though he admits his body isn’t in the best shape. He added: “It’s embarrassing, I’ve never been to a gym or really done any sports… but I’m not lazy as I’m always working or busy doing something.”

Rupert, Emma, Bonnie and Daniel To Attend The 2010 National Movie Awards!
Posted by Megs

Rupert Grint, Emma Watson, Bonnie Wright and Daniel Radcliffe are all scheduled to attend the 2010 National Movie Awards on May 26th.  Harry Potter is nominated in a few categories:

Half-Blood Prince is up in the “Family” category against movies such as Up and Nanny McPhee 2.

Emma Watson, Rupert Grint and Daniel Radcliffe are all up for “Performance of the Year” against the likes of Kristen Stewart, Robert Pattinson, Emma Thompson, Zoe Saldana, Sam Worthington, Johnny Depp, Helena Bonham Carter and more!

It will air in the UK at 8pm in ITV1! Thanks ICM!

Epilogue Filming for Deathly Hallows & Photos of the Trio
Posted by Megs

Some very interesting reports are going around the internet today, first we have a report from RGN stating that the Deathly Hallows epilogue is filming! Sad, but awesome! “I wandered down to King’s Cross Station this fine May morning, in the hope that Warner Brothers are not aware of the level of interest in their little film, and that the public would be casually able to stop and watch Rupert Grint and fellow cast members filming the Deathly Hallows epilogue. It was not a huge surprise to find out that Warner Brothers are cleverer than I am, and that they have taken steps to prevent passing passersby from discovering just how gorgeous a thirty-seven year old Auror is. Despite the utter failure of my secret mission, it is worth letting you know that epilogue filming is underway, and should continue all week, because I am sure that you all want to know that this amazing decade long cinematic journey is nearly over.”

Also, there are some photos of the trio leaving their hotel with their faces covered; prosthetics for the epilogue perhaps? But they are wearing the same clothes from an earlier scene in the movie so who knows?  See the photos in the gallery!
